Output 8470064aaa0f3e536f2ac6532fcbc053260ba7509889427b7e7338030931d863:5

value
806658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d09cf05d7ff32adecb3df5c16d9219e622632e83 OP_EQUAL
address
3Li4UkauB1xQH39szoMV4oz49stGFtZhHU
transaction
8470064aaa0f3e536f2ac6532fcbc053260ba7509889427b7e7338030931d863
confirmations
200627
spent
true